Can I have two houses under my name?

It is legal to own more than one house in India. In India, there are no limits on how many properties a family or individual can own. The purchase of multiple properties can have tax implications depending on their location and usage. 01-Feb-2023

Can a property be registered in three names in India?

It is possible to register the property in a joint name. Property can be registered under the joint names of more than two individuals. This is legal.
